What Is Stainless Steel?

Stainless steel is a highly durable material used across a wide range of industries, from construction to automotive and even medical applications. As its name implies, stainless steel has high corrosion resistance and can withstand extreme temperatures and heavy impacts. 

Stainless steel is composed of chromium, iron, and other metals which give it its unique properties. It also contains trace amounts of carbon which helps increase strength while maintaining its malleability.

This combination gives stainless steel the ability to resist staining and rusting in both indoor and outdoor environments. 

In addition, the smooth surface makes it easy to clean and maintain for years of use without the need for special treatments or coatings. Because it is so strong yet versatile at the same time, stainless steel is an ideal material for a variety of applications. 

It can be bent, moulded, and shaped into almost any form with the right production process, making it a great choice for projects ranging from home appliances to aircraft engines. 

Stainless steel is also widely used in food processing and storage as it does not leach out toxic substances or flavours when exposed to moisture and heat. All these benefits make stainless steel one of the most popular materials used today.

Benefits Of Stainless Steel

There are several benefits to using stainless steel as a metal for rings:

Cost-Effective

Stainless steel competes with tungsten and titanium in terms of price, looks, and durability.

Stainless steel also has a low price tag. Wedding bands made of tungsten and stainless steel are included for your perusal to illustrate this point. Since their costs are comparable, they can serve as reasonable substitutes for more expensive white metals.

Appearance

The low cost of stainless steel should not be a false economy. Its durability and strength are unparalleled, even when compared to platinum.

The reflective surface makes it bright and shiny, making it difficult for the average person to tell the difference between it and more expensive white metals. Stainless steel rings can be given a wide variety of looks by having various finishes applied to them.

Durability

One major perk of stainless steel rings is that they can be worn daily without fear of scuffs or other visible signs of wear and tear. That’s why it’s so great for those who like to stay on the go all day long.

Bands made of stainless steel don’t have to be taken off before doing things like swimming, playing sports, cleaning, or gardening, unlike rings made of other metals.

Simple To Maintain

Stainless steel jewellery requires minimal upkeep. To keep its lustrous and lovely appearance, you need only use water and soap. Due to its resistance to rusting and scratching, metal is more easily maintained in its lustrous state.

For these reasons, it is a great alternative metal for use in wedding bands worn by both men and women.

Resizing Difficulties

Stainless steel bands are notoriously difficult to resize due to their rigidity and general unworkability. You must know your ring size precisely when placing an order or be willing to have the band resized.

Because stainless steel is so inexpensive, resizing rings made from it is usually not worthwhile.

There Is No Assurance That It Is Allergen-Free

Although it will depend on the alloys used, some people may develop an allergic reaction to stainless steel because of their extreme sensitivity to metals.

One possible cause of this is the presence of nickel, which is an allergen for many people. Surgical stainless steel, which typically includes several different alloys, is the recommended material.
